2025 Top Mobile App Development Platform

2025 Top Mobile App Development Platform

Mobile Development Era Begun in 2007 , in next 3 year smartphone wave reach to market ! 

2007 
- Apple launch iPhone with pre installed application.

2008 
- Apple Introduce the AppStore 
- Google Release Android and Android Market 

2010
- Native Apps comes in Market and growing superbly

2011
- Cross Platform comes into Market like : PhoneGap, Cardova

2012
- Android Introduce Google Play Store and Replacing the Android market 

2013
- Ionic Framework (hybrid) Introduced  

2014
Apple Indroduce Swift language - more developer friendly language for iOS development.

2015 
Facebook lanuch React Native - Cross Platform | WOW !

2016 
First Stable Release of kotlin for Android Developers 
Google Release First Beta of Flutter !

2017 
Google officially Adopt Kotlin for Android Development 
Progressive web apps growing rapidly.

2018 
Flutter Launch 1.0 for Market !

2019 
Kotlin MultipPlatform Introduced for Android and iOS

2021
Compose MultiPlatform | CMP Announced 

2022 
KMP Gets stable release and wider adoption in the Market where teams sharing business logic but Custom UI for Android and iOS both manage differently. 

2024 
Compose MultiPlatform comes with Android, iOS, Desktop and Web App development with Single Code Based. Bingo ! 


Native vs Hybrid vs Cross Platform 

Native Platform 
Specially build to take care single platform like:  Android and iOS

Hybrid Platform
Web Development language using HTML, CSS, and JavaScript into native apps using bridge for plugin like: Apache Cordova to deploy on multiple platform. This knd of apps runs inside a webview.

Cross Platform 
Hybrid and cross platform looks similar because of code sharing feature with multiple platform but both are different. Cross Platform have their own language | framework and compile to native code for multiple platform which gives you native experience.


FeatureNativeHybridCross-Platform
PerformanceHighModerate to LowModerate to High
Development CostHighLowModerate
Time to MarketLongerFasterModerate
CodebaseSeparate for each appSingle for all platformsSingle for all platforms
Device FeaturesFull accessLimited (via plugins)Full access (via libraries)
UI/UX ConsistencyHighLowModerate
Best forComplex, performance-sensitive appsSimple appsApps needing moderate performance across platforms

 

Which one is better for you?

This is always depends on the requirements and approach, Discuss with IT consultant to get more clarity of path , it saves your time and cost ! Simply we added our point of view 

- If Performance choose native along with advance feature building.
- Quick Prototype | MVP hybrid would be take less time and cost.
- If need a good balance between performance and cost, Cross platform would be good.


Top 2025 Mobile App development Platform in the Market

1. Android | Kotiln | Kotlin Multi Platform | Compose Multi Platform 

2. iOS | Objective C | Swift | Swift UI 

3. React Native 

4. Flutter 

5. Xmarine | MiUi

6. Ioinic 


What is Top Platform as for now ?

- Easiest and Simple always Picked first, here is Flutter as per the market demand.

- In Recent time React Native Introduced v0.76 which is far better than older version and resolving many complexity for developer. Hoping for a good comeback.

- Google working towards Compose MultiPlatform (CMP) which is now spreading in the Market. Native language providing cross platform solution. This is also fascinating.


As per Professionals opinion sooner demands switch to kotlin and in this years Kotlin, Flutter will be leading the development market. 


Few Debate running in the market ! 
- Market Compare Flutter vs React Native ?
- Soon Market Compare Flutter vs React Native vs CMP (Compose MultiPlatform)
- Now the real question, What is Apple doing for their Competitor?
- Are low code platform impact market?


What is Low code Platform?
1. OutSystems [Enterprise Grade Capabilities]
2. Mendix 
3. Zoho Creator 
4. Appian 
5. Microsoft Power App 
6. 
Bubble.io
7. FlutterFlow
8. BuildFire

Jobseeker

Looking For Job?
Submit Resume Now

Recruiter

Are You Recruiting?
Post a job